How many quarts of oil does the 2010 Audi Q5 require?

In an Audi Q5 from 2010, you'll need 6.6 quarts of oil during an oil change. It's important to swap out the oil every 5,000 to 10,000 miles to keep your engine running smoothly. If you neglect this maintenance, you could encounter engine issues. Using high-quality oil is crucial for optimal engine performance. Neglecting oil changes can lead to problems like a strong burning smell, which should be addressed promptly to prevent potential danger, such as the risk of the car catching fire. Continuing to use old or low-quality oil can cause the engine to fail, resulting in symptoms like engine knocking and reduced gas mileage.

    The 2010 Audi Q5 requires 6.6 quarts of engine oil when changing the filter. It is important to use the oil recommended by Audi, which meets the 502 00 standard.
